The Forest Management Bureau conducted a Hybrid Workshop to complete and finalize the CY 2018-2024 accomplishments related to the ground delineation of production forests for investments at Ardenhills Suites, Quezon City.
Since the implementation of the delineation activity in 2018, the DENR Field Offices identified areas suitable for production purposes such as agroforestry, grazing, tree plantation, ecotourism, and other special uses, as guided by FMB Technical Bulletin No 5-A.
The workshop aimed to thoroughly review the submitted accomplishments of the Regional and Field Offices and finalize all delineated Potential Investment Areas (PIA), ensuring that these PIAs are free from overlaps with any forestry tenure or management arrangements, and projects.
As part of the Bureau’s commitment in the Philippine Development Plan (PDP) 2023-2028, these PIAs will form part of the land development of the forest investment portal “Tagpuan” and will be marketed to potential investors.
The hybrid workshop was participated by selected FMB personnel and representatives from the DENR Central Office and DENR Regional Offices of Cordillera Administrative Region (CAR), Regions I, II, IV-A (CALABARZON, IV-B (MIMAROPA), V-VIII, IX, and XI-XIII
